[PATCH v5 4/5] block/io: fix bdrv_is_allocated_above


From: Vladimir Sementsov-Ogievskiy
Subject: [PATCH v5 4/5] block/io: fix bdrv_is_allocated_above
Date: Wed, 10 Jun 2020 15:04:25 +0300

bdrv_is_allocated_above wrongly handles short backing files: it reports
after-EOF space as UNALLOCATED which is wrong, as on read the data is
generated on the level of short backing file (if all overlays has
unallocated area at that place).

Reusing bdrv_common_block_status_above fixes the issue and unifies code
path.
